Kieran Culkin may have Hollywood charm, but his proposal was anything but glamorous.
His wife, Jazz Charton, revealed that the Succession star popped the question in a rather unexpected spot: between two dumpsters.
In an interview with The Sunday Times published March 23, Jazz recalled the unorthodox moment, which happened during a road trip to California.
“He got down between two dumpsters and said, ‘Will you marry me?’” she laughed. “I was, like, ‘Really, here? I mean, yes, obviously, but really?’”
Despite the setting, Jazz had no doubts about saying yes.
She knew Kieran was the one early on, especially after their memorable first meeting at a New York bar.
“He was very forward but hilariously so,” she shared, revealing that when she asked for the name of a restaurant he mentioned, he shot back, “No, you idiot, I want to take you there.”
Earlier this month, Jazz found herself in the spotlight after Kieran’s emotional Oscars win for A Real Pain.
During his acceptance speech, he reminded her of a promise she once made — that if he ever won an Academy Award, she’d give him a fourth child.
Charton later took to Instagram to celebrate her husband’s milestone, joking that the “empty baby pacts” proved to be a great motivator.
